-
Identify the Switch Terminals:
Begin by locating the terminals on the universal headlight switch. Each terminal represents a specific circuit within the headlight system. These are usually numbered or lettered for easy identification. Consult the diagram to understand the function of each terminal. Take note of any markings or labels on the switch itself.
-
Match Terminals to the Diagram:
Using the wiring diagram, carefully match the terminals on the switch to their corresponding positions on the schematic. Pay close attention to wire colors and symbols to ensure accuracy. Any discrepancy between the diagram and the actual switch could indicate a problem that needs further investigation. Double-checking every connection is crucial before proceeding.
-
Trace the Wiring Paths:
Follow the path of each wire from the switch to its destination, such as the headlights, relay, or fuse box. The diagram provides a visual guide for this process. This step helps determine the function of individual wires and ensure they are correctly routed and connected. A systematic approach is recommended to avoid confusion.

What are the potential consequences of incorrect wiring based on the diagram?
Incorrect wiring can have serious consequences, ranging from simple headlight malfunction to more severe issues. A short circuit can damage the switch, wiring harness, or even the vehicle’s electrical system. This could lead to electrical fires, blown fuses, or other malfunctions that can affect driving safety. Always double-check your work.
How can the diagram aid in troubleshooting headlight problems?
The diagram acts as a roadmap to trace the electrical pathway. By systematically checking each connection and component shown on the diagram, you can isolate faulty areas. This includes checking for blown fuses, damaged wires, or problems with the switch itself. This systematic approach often leads to a quicker and more efficient solution.

Tips for Working with a Universal Headlight Switch Wiring Diagram
Working effectively with a universal headlight switch wiring diagram requires a systematic approach and attention to detail. A methodical process significantly reduces the risk of errors and ensures safe operation. Understanding the nuances of the diagram is essential for proficient use.
Always begin by thoroughly studying the diagram before starting any electrical work. Carefully reviewing the components, symbols, and wire color codes is a crucial first step. This careful examination prevents misinterpretations and potential problems.
Always Disconnect the Battery
Before any work on the electrical system, always disconnect the negative terminal of the battery. This vital safety precaution prevents accidental short circuits and shocks. This is an essential safety measure and should never be overlooked.
Double-Check Wire Connections
After making each connection, carefully double-check the wiring. Ensure that each wire is securely connected to the correct terminal. Verifying connections minimizes the risk of errors and subsequent problems. A second check minimizes issues.
Use Appropriate Tools
Use the correct tools when working with electrical components. Use insulated pliers, screwdrivers, and other tools that are appropriate for the task. Using appropriate tools is a safety measure that reduces the risk of damage and injury. Suitable tools are crucial.
Consult the Vehicle’s Manual
For any discrepancies or uncertainties, consult the vehicle’s specific wiring diagram. This provides crucial vehicle-specific details. The vehicle manual offers critical details.
Test the System Thoroughly
After completing all wiring, thoroughly test the headlight system to ensure everything functions correctly. Test both high and low beams, and verify that all functions work as expected. This testing step helps identify any unresolved issues.
